## What's an Apify Actor?

Actors are web data automations that power AI and operations. They run on the Apify platform to scrape websites, process data, connect APIs, and automate workflows.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.

## Healthcare Practice Affiliation + Stack Detector

### What you are looking at

Once a practice signs with a DSO or MSO it stops being a target. Nothing tracks that.

### Why it costs you

So acquisition teams work lists where a slice of the rows were affiliated months ago and find out on the call, and vendors selling into independents waste the same calls from the other side. In a consolidating specialty that slice grows every quarter.

### What this actor does

Point this actor at practice websites. It reads affiliation off the practice's own pages (a parent named in the copyright line, a corporate careers link, one of 120+ known consolidators across dental, vet, vision, dermatology, physical therapy and multi-specialty), and returns provider count, location count and the practice-management system. A free, keyless NPPES lookup is included to cross-check against the federal provider registry.

### Start here

Run it on one specialty in one state. Every row that comes back independent with a provider count is a scored origination target.

### Measured accuracy

88 to 97% of qualified practices return an actionable verdict. Provider count fills 74-89%. Affiliation is only ever asserted when the parent is named on the practice's own pages; 'likely independent' is an absence-of-evidence finding and is labelled as such on purpose.

# Actor output Schema

## `results` (type: `string`):

Determines whether a medical, dental, veterinary, optometry or therapy practice is still INDEPENDENT or already owned by a DSO/MSO/PE platform, names the parent group where one exists, and returns provider count, location count and the practice-management system (Dentrix, Open Dental, Eaglesoft, Curve, Denticon, ezyVet, athenahealth, eClinicalWorks, ModMed, WebPT). Built for roll-up acquisition origination and for vendors selling into independent practices.
